Job Description

Key Responsibilities:


Strategic Financial Planning

  • Lead annual operating plans (AOP), quarterly forecasts, and long-term strategic planning processes.
  • Build robust financial models and scenario plans to support company-level and BU-level decision-making.

2. Business Finance

  • Act as a financial business partner to key functions like operations, sales, supply chain, and product.
  • Evaluate new projects, pricing decisions, discount structures, and marketing ROI.

3. Inventory Finance & Working Capital Optimization

  • Collaborate with supply chain, commercial, and procurement teams to drive inventory finance planning.
  • Monitor key metrics like inventory turns, and vendor payment cycles.

4. Performance Analysis & Reporting

  • Deliver monthly MIS, variance analysis (Budget vs. Actual), and performance dashboards.
  • Support board presentations, investor decks, and internal reviews.

5. Cost Control & Financial Governance

  • Drive cost rationalization initiatives across departments while maintaining service levels.
  • Track key cost heads: logistics, marketing, manpower, warehousing, and tech spends.
  • Strengthen budgeting discipline and internal controls.

7. Team & Stakeholder Management

  • Mentor a high-performing FP&A and business finance team.
  • Collaborate cross-functionally with other functions.
  • Serve as a thought partner to the finance controller and leadership on strategic initiatives.


Key Requirements

  • 3+ years of Post MBA experience in FP&A, business finance, or strategic finance, with exposure to inventory-heavy businesses.
  • Or Chartered Accountant (CA) with 6+ years of post-qualification experience, with strong exposure to financial planning, business finance, or strategic finance roles.
  • Deep expertise in financial modeling, forecasting, budgeting, and commercial finance.
  • Hands-on experience in managing inventory finance and working capital.
  •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ills.
  • Strong analytical mindset with attention to detail and a bias for action.


Preferred Qualifications

  • CA or MBA (Finance) from Tier 1/2 institutes (IIMs, ISB, XLRI, FMS, ICAI, etc.)
  • Prior experience in e-commerce, pharma distribution, FMCG, or retail sectors.
  • Familiarity with ERP (SAP/Oracle), planning tools (Anaplan, Hyperion), and BI platforms.
